The West Midlands was once dubbed the workshop of the world with its heavy industry and manufacturing plants. While these sectors have declined – although they still contribute to the region’s economy – the West Midlands reinvented itself as a focus for hi-tech industries and leisure. Regional cities include Birmingham, Wolverhampton, Coventry and Stafford. Elsewhere, the West Midlands has notable tourist attractions that include Ironbridge, Warwick Castle and Stratford upon Avon, Shakespeare’s birthplace.
